Why the (insert explitive here) doesn't Live Chess have the 50-move rule or 3-fold repetition????????? Or does it? Perhaps I counted wrong or maybe I made a mistake but I very nearly lost on time in an obviously drawn position...... and only by luck did my opponent choose to exchange and get a draw by insufficient material. Aren't 50 moves without a pawn move or a capture a draw? Isn't it a draw when the same position is repeated on the board three times?? IAren't those standard rules??

Your recollection of the rules is off in one small detail: You need to claim the draw by threefold repetition or by the 50 move rule. Either side can claim the draw, but If neither side does, the game isn't drawn - after all, if both sides "want" to play, it's fine to do so.
Chess.com recognizes and can handle both; the "Draw" button isn't just for draw offers, but for draw claims as well. Once either threefold repetition or a 50 move rule case occur, you can press it for an instant draw. Try it next time!
